This is a complete mirror kit for Chevrolet and GMC trucks, panels, suburbans, 1947 to 1955 first series. This is all made out of high quality chrome finish with stainless. The two arms in chrome, round bu inch mirror heads rubber mounting gaskets and 4 stainless screws.
